    I own the R6 and I was just out a few days ago when it was over 40°C (with humidity) outside in Ontario While my 2.5 year old rode his super slow little ATV. I just purchased the RF 70-200 F2.8 so I was testing it out with a mixture of photos and little clips of video (10 sec - 4min max). I noticed the handle getting warmer and warmer and by the time I got home I just saw the heat warning come on. We didn’t make it very far but I’d say we were outside for maybe about an hour and a half with some water breaks and the camera was not in use the entire time. My screen was in the closed position and my videos were 4K 30 FPS.
    I think this is the second or third time that I’ve seen the heat warning come on. First time was while recording my son‘s birthday I left the camera recording on a tripod while the party was going on.
    When I purchased the RF 70 to 200 I asked if it would drain batteries quicker with having to focus a larger lens [I am used to using the EF 24 to 70 F4] she told me there wouldn’t be any difference but I think there is a difference in battery life and maybe this contributed to additional heat. I also recently started to increased my screen brightness to the maximum of 7 when I usually keep it at 4 in sunny conditions but also use the EVF quite a bit.
    I don’t know why I put all these details but maybe it’ll help someone to know some of the intricacies that led to the heat warning on the R6.
